    Made a bit more progress over the past few days. Rented a spring compressor from Autozone and got the front strut assemblies stripped down:




    I measured 2-1/8" up from the bottom of the strut housing to make my cut and whipped out the portaband saw. This cut does not need to be perfectly square and precise (but you should still take pride in your work and get it close ):



    Got the remains of the original strut housing prepped for welding:



    I prepped the coilover tubes and drilled a few holes in the bottom of them so that I could plug weld them:



    One thing I really like about this coilover design is that the bottom coilover tube inner diameter is machined so that it fits very snug around the original BMW strut housing, which ensures that the new coilover assembly will be positioned correctly when everything is welded up. Here is how it sits before welding. I set the bottom of the tube 1" up the strut housing:



    My TIG welds aren't nearly as beautiful as some other guys', definitely still getting the hang of it. I'm confident with the penetration of the welds, but my technique could use some work. Anyways, got them all welded up:



    Gave the bottoms a coat of paint and assembled the coilovers!




    Now that that was done, the next task on my list was to take care of these guys:



    My friend Rob let me borrow this handy tool to press the lollipops onto the control arms, worked great:



    And there we have it folks:



    Started putting things back on the car, including the Ireland Engineering front sway bar:





    I put the original rotors back on for now just so I could roll the car around, the new brakes will go on at a later time within the next few weeks. I won't be able to actually drive the car again until the full suspension rebuild and 5-speed swap is done so it'll be a little wait, plus the battery is toast (keep forgetting about that). I have a lot of work ahead of me! Happy to be making progress.
